3D RECORDING CHALLENGES AND SOLUTIONS 3D recording challenges Precise adjustment of vertical position gaps between the left and right cameras to prevent eye fatigue and other adverse effects. Preventing vertical and horizontal rotation or inversion of one or both images caused by different camera rig settings. Creating top-quality 3D content that will not cause eye fatigue and other adverse effects. DT-3D24G1 solutions Convenient camera-assist functions help in adjusting vertical position gaps and correcting left and right images regardless of the camera rig setting selected in advance. The approximate counting, measuring, and/or calculating of pixels are no longer necessary thanks to handy functions such as Cursor Mode and Grid Mode. The value of pixels and percentages are clearly displayed to help in determining the correct amount of binocular disparity.
